I think the use of the Sustenance spell is only controversial when it is insisted that it removes or reduces the Essence Drain requirement. I personally feel it's kind of a cheeseweasel method of getting a power bump without paying the in-game price, and isn't really reflected in the in-game descriptions of how HMHVV works, but mechanically it seems sound.
